  &lt;p&gt;&lt;big&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Reaching for the Stars&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/big&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;Bare branches of trees reach for stars in this starry November night of Sweden. This carefully framed black &amp; white photo also shows the North America Nebula at right and the Andromeda Galaxy at the upper left. — &lt;em&gt;&lt;a href="http://Clearskies.se"&gt;P-M Heden&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;blockquote&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href="http://www.theverge.com/2013/3/15/4107980/play-this-super-stickman-golf-2"&gt;Play this: ‘Super Stickman Golf 2’ is like regular golf, but crazy&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Fishing isn’t the only mundane sport that can be improved through the power of video games: golf gets better with an ample dose of crazy, too. Available on iOS and Android, Super Stickman Golf 2 is the follow-up to the beloved original, and it doesn’t mess with the formula too much. You’ll still be trying to get a ball in a hole while navigating courses that would give even Super Mario a headache, using simple but intuitive controls and helpful power-ups.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/blockquote&gt;</description><link>http://kiriappeee.tumblr.com/post/45447068952</link><guid>http://kiriappeee.tumblr.com/post/45447068952</guid><pubDate>Sat, 16 Mar 2013 03:41:16 +0530</pubDate></item><item><title>Remember Aaron Swartz: Official Statement from the family and partner of Aaron Swartz </title><description>Remember Aaron Swartz: Official Statement from the family and partner of Aaron Swartz :...</description><link>http://kiriappeee.tumblr.com/post/40383087461</link><guid>http://kiriappeee.tumblr.com/post/40383087461</guid><pubDate>Sun, 13 Jan 2013 06:33:20 +0530</pubDate></item><item><title>zerply:

&l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;a href="http://inhabitat.com/harvard-scientist-proposes-a-way-to-refreeze-the-arctic-to-combat-possible-global-warming-disaster/#more-466812"&gt;Harvard Scientist Proposes a Way to Refreeze the Arctic to Combat Possible Global Warming Disaster&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;The amount of ice in the Arctic Ocean shrunk to an all time low in September, with the area covered now only half of what it was in the 1980s. This alarming development along with the global community’s inability to come to a consensus about cutting CO2 emissions has led Harvard professor of applied physics David Keith to look at a technological solution to reversing the warming of the Arctic. In a paper published in &lt;em&gt;Nature Climate Change&lt;/em&gt; and an affiliated study in the &lt;em&gt;Environmental Research Letters&lt;/em&gt;, Keith proposes a way to refreeze the Arctic through geoengineering.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;Injecting reflective particles into the high atmosphere could reduce the amount of sunlight reaching the Earth’s surface, counteracting the greenhouse gas effect. High CO2 levels would continue to trap heat in the atmosphere, but with less energy coming in, temperatures on the surface would go down. Keith suggests using the method for a regional correction to restore the ice cover in the Arctic. In his paper, he claims that “with an average solar reduction of only 0.5%, it is possible to recover pre-industrial sea ice extent.” A separate paper shows that this could all be done with a few modified Gulfstream jets and is estimated to cost around $8 billion, which is about the price of a installing a major oil pipeline.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;But large-scale geoengineering like what Keith is suggesting is banned by the United Nations Convention on Biological Diversity because it could result in disastrous unintended consequences. Even Keith acknowledges that manually refreezing the arctic is not the right way to solve the larger problem of global warming. He thinks that this level of geoengineering would only be appropriate to consider in states of emergency such as a sudden collapse of ice sheets or a killing drought. But first, we need to cut our greenhouse gas emissions and he warns that “if we do this and we do not cut emissions, we just walk further and further off the cliff, like Wile E. Coyote.”&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;blockquote&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;big&gt;&lt;a href="http://www.space.com/18893-black-hole-jets-similarities.html"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Black Holes Spew Out Surprise&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/big&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;blockquote&gt;
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Black holes come in a variety of sizes, ranging from 10 times the mass of the sun to a billion times as massive. But new research shows that black holes of completely different masses, ages and locations can produce jets of ionized gas that behave similarly.&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Image:&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;em&gt;This illustration shows a black hole emitting jets of fast-moving plasma above and below it, as matter swirls around in an orbiting disk.&lt;/em&gt; &lt;strong&gt;Credit:&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;em&gt;NASA’s Goddard Space Flight Center &lt;/em&gt;&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;“As scientists, we are always seeking universal principles,” Rodrigo Nemmen, of NASA’s Goddard Space Flight Center in Greenbelt, Md., told SPACE.com.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;Nemmen and his colleagues studied a wide variety of black holes in an attempt to compare how efficiently their jets emitted light. “I was very surprised,” Nemmen said of the results.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;Discovering similarities between ancient supermassive black holes in the center of distant galaxies and baby black holes born as stars collapse should help scientists gain a firmer understanding of these jets.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Cosmic accelerators&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;Black holes are well known for their ability to pull matter into them. But not all material near a black hole finds itself lost. Some bits of matter just outside the point of no return (called the event horizon) are accelerated away at near-light speeds, creating jets of particles shooting out above and below the black holes.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;“I like to call black holes ‘cosmic LHCs,’ or very powerful particle accelerators,” Nemmen said, referring to the Large Hadron Collider, an underground machine in Switzerland that speeds protons to 99.9999991 percent the speed of light.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;When matter is spun away from a black hole in the form of a jet, most of its energy goes into its motion, but some of it is changed into light in the form of gamma-rays. Nemmen and his team studied findings on 293 previously observed black holes and calculated how efficiently the jets converted energy to light. They found that the rate scaled across the range of black holes.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;“This was one of the surprises of this work, that this efficiency of conversion of the energy into light is essentially the same for black holes with very different masses, very different ages and completely different environments,” Nemmen said.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;Black holes are powerful beasts, interesting in and of themselves. But by accelerating ionized gas, they also have the potential to change their environment. Heating up space, they could affect the production of new stars, thereby influencing the galaxy they live in.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;“These jets might be powerful agents of creating changes in the host galaxy,” Nemmen said.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;Scientists still don’t have a strong understanding of how these violent particle outflows form. But the fact that the energy efficiency of the jets scales across black holes may help theorists better understand how something that pulls in most particles could shoot away others, and how the outflow of energy may affect surrounding space.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
  
  &lt;p&gt;&lt;small&gt;The findings were published online today (Dec. 13) in the journal Science.&lt;/small&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
